Hebrew word study

צֶרֶתTsereth Tsereth, an Israelite

Pronounced “tseh'-reth

Tsereth, an Israelite

Translated in the King James as: Zereth.

Origin: perhaps from H6671 (צָהַר); splendor;

Read it in context & ask Abram about this word

Where it appears

1 Chronicles 1×
1 Chr 4:7
